Article
Molecular genetic analysis in 21 Chinese families with congenital insensitivity to pain with or without anhidrosis.
European journal of neurology - 1 Aug 2020
Zhao F, Mao B, Geng X, Ren X, Wang Y, Guan Y, Li S, Li L, Zhang S, You Y, Cao Y, Yang T, Zhao X
Abstract excerpt
BACKGROUND AND PURPOSE: Hereditary sensory and autonomic neuropathies (HSANs) are a group of clinically and genetically heterogeneous neurological disorders characterized by sensory dysfunctions. Here, 21 affected Chinese families are reported, including 19 with congenital insensitivity to pain with anhidrosis (CIPA; namely HSAN IV) and two with congenital insensitivity to pain (CIP; namely HSAN IID) caused by...
